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00074262 07774740865 6296154617 3000 568
87819219 12836919600
87819219 12836919600
220 581027114 32430
All about undefined
Interested in learning more?
87819219 12836919600
220 581027114 32430
See more
71623003180 47487 089
3018517388 179645 25502408 02333020
See more
225453980 701512731
8157 5322818 006601823
See more